AI Verdict

IGR BEARISH

Despite a strong Piotroski F-Score of 7/9 indicating operational health, IGR exhibits severe valuation and sustainability concerns. The stock trades at a significant premium to both its Graham Number ($3.48) and Intrinsic Value ($0.84), while revenue is contracting by 15.30% YoY. Most critically, the 600% dividend payout ratio indicates that the 15.35% yield is fundamentally unsustainable and likely funded by capital returns rather than earnings. The combination of negative growth and a disconnected valuation outweighs the strong deterministic health score.

TBLD NEUTRAL

The deterministic health profile is severely compromised, highlighted by a Piotroski F-Score of 1/9, indicating significant operational weakness. While the trust exhibits a very attractive P/E ratio of 7.38 and a sustainable dividend yield of 5.52%, it is currently trading at a premium to its intrinsic value of $21.49. Strong historical price performance is currently offset by a highly bearish technical trend (10/100) and weak insider sentiment. Overall, the asset functions as an income vehicle but lacks the fundamental health markers required for a bullish rating.
